LAKE BUENA VISTA, Fla. (July 24, 2003) -- You're tempted to roll your eyes and shake your head. You begin to wonder if the guy is serious or seriously lost on the mother of all ego trips.

How great of a football player is Simeon Rice? Let him count the ways -- that is, of course, if you don't have any pressing engagements. You're going to be there a while.

But then it occurs to you that the Tampa Bay Buccaneers defensive end isn't boasting at all, because he can back up everything he says with his performance on the field. He is one of the most dominant forces in the game, regardless of position. He is a tremendous athlete with incredible speed and power. He is, as he puts it, "just too much to hold and too hot to handle."

Rice led the NFC last season with 15 1/2 sacks. He made some of his biggest plays in the biggest games -- playoff victories over San Francisco and Philadelphia, as well as the 48-21 win over Oakland in Super Bowl XXXVII. Rice, in fact, probably should have been the Super Bowl MVP.
